Transaction 87da07e57f704df384f90ad3341dea41a3e498a806984ffa027264f6b54213b2
1 Input
1 Output
-
87da07e57f704df384f90ad3341dea41a3e498a806984ffa027264f6b54213b2:0
- value
- 12046318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0acf78164b792c579a93cf58f9a52ecdabef949a OP_EQUAL
- address
- M8tKXZ4YYP63CW1TVM8VhCemhFZtPKEBe6